Preview


Most teams sitting at 2-0 would be pretty pleased with the start made to a season, but there are some concerns about this Philadelphia Eagles (2-0) team. They have beaten the Dallas Cowboys and Kansas City Chiefs, but the Eagles have not been as dominant as they were closing out last season and some have criticised the early play-calling from new Offensive Co-Ordinator Sean Patullo.

The Super Bowl Champions crushed all that opposed them in the Playoff last season, but the one game that almost got away from the Philadelphia Eagles was against the Los Angeles Rams (2-0).

Matthew Stafford and company were driving with a chance to take the lead in that Playoff game, but the Eagles did enough to just edge over the line.

It does mean Philadelphia have won three in a row against the Rams, including beating them twice last season, and this is a chance to just remind the rest of the NFL that they remain the team to beat.

Saquon Barkley was a huge part of the successes that the Eagles had all season, but he had been particularly dominant against the Los Angeles Rams in the two meetings against them in the 2024 season. This has led to the Rams looking to make some changes on the Defensive Line to slow things down and they have made a positive start to the season, although it will be interesting to see how they deal with the Eagles on Sunday.

The Philadelphia Offensive Line continues to look very strong, but they have yet to really find the rhythm that saw them contribute to some huge numbers produced by Barkley at Running Back.

That is where the criticism of some of the play-calling has been raised with people believing the Eagles calls are predictable, and thus that much easier to defend.

Head Coach Nick Sirianni even suggested that there has to be something of a change, but the Eagles will still want to be a power running team and they will give Saquon Barkley plenty of touches. He ripped off some huge runs in the wins over the Los Angeles Rams last season and the Eagles will be hoping to see more of the same, while also making sure Jalen Hurts is in third and manageable spots on the field.

The Quarter Back has not put up the big passing numbers, but Jalen Hurts has been efficient when dropping back to throw and he has also been pretty well protection. We will see that protection tested by this Rams pass rush, but being in front of the chains means Hurts will not have to hold onto the ball for too long and he could have Dallas Goedert back at Tight End.

Los Angeles fans will point to some solid Defensive numbers, but those have come against Houston and Tennessee who have a combined 0-4 record. This time the test is much greater and the Philadelphia Eagles will be confident they can continue to move the ball against this Defensive unit.

Running the ball is also key for the Rams in this game and they will have noted that the closest of the last three losses to the Philadelphia Eagles was in the Playoff game when the team managed to reach triple digits on the ground. They had not done that in the previous two games and the early performances of this Los Angeles Offensive Line will offer plenty of encouragement ahead of this game.

Early performances have seen the Rams pile up some solid numbers on the ground and Philadelphia's Defensive Line may have some problems containing Kyren Williams. With an Offensive mind like Sean McVay as Head Coach, Los Angeles will have some sweeps and other misdirection plays to ensure they are not sitting too far behind the chains in this one and giving Matthew Stafford the best opportunity to set his team up for a victory.

The veteran Quarter Back has made a decent start to the season and there will be a real hope that he can lead the Rams to another Super Bowl success.

Matthew Stafford should have time in the pocket, as long as the Rams are finding a way to remain in third and manageable, but he will also be dealing with a young Philadelphia Secondary that have looked in good rhythm to start the year. He does have a couple of quality Receivers to make plays down the field and the Los Angeles Rams are expected to make this a contest, even if they do come up a little short.

Consecutive road games in the early 1pm Sunday slot is tough, but even more so when a team from the West Coast has to head out East.

Jalen Hurts has also had a positive record when set as the home favourite and this game will feel important to the Philadelphia Eagles. It should be a fun game, which goes all the way down to the final two minutes of the Fourth Quarter, but the Eagles have found a way to get the better of this opponent and they can do that again on their way to a 3-0 start.
